Comparing Serbia with Albany Park, Illinois

Compare Climate information for Serbia and Albany Park, Illinois

Is Serbia warmer or hotter than Albany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, yes, Serbia is hotter than Albany Park, Illinois . Serbia has an average temperature of 14°C/57°F and Albany Park, Illinois has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F.

Serbia's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than Albany Park, Illinois's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).

Is Serbia colder or cooler than Albany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, no, Serbia is not colder than Albany Park, Illinois . Serbia has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F and Albany Park, Illinois has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F.



Serbia's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-2°C/28°F, which is not colder than Albany Park, Illinois's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-7°C/19°F).

Does Serbia have more rain than Albany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, no, Serbia has less rain than Albany Park, Illinois. Serbia has an average annual rainfall of 577mm and Albany Park, Illinois has an average annual rainfall of 1012mm.

Serbia's wettest month is May, with an average monthly rainfall of 85mm, which is drier than Albany Park, Illinois's wettest month (also May, with an average monthly rainfall of 133mm).
